Using PL/SQL Tables

Oracle Database Tips by Donald Burleson

Many times a PL/SQL programmer will create a database level table to hold intermediate results. This creation of an intermediate table results in IO, recursive SQL and the associated time delays and performance costs. By using as PL/SQL table constructed in memory the cost of using a database table and populating it is eliminated, many times at a significant performance improvement.

PL/SQL tables should not be used for large data loads or large processing requirements, they are most suitable for loading look up values that are scanned repetitively or for small intermediate result table. One limitation is that any needed file generation will have to be moved from SQL into UTL_FILE since standard SQL (non-PL/SQL) cannot read the PL/SQL tables.   For an example look at the database recreation script generator in Figure 23.

Figure 23: Example DB Script Generator

While there are many inefficiencies in the PL/SQL code, notice that it first creates a temporary table, truncates it and then once it is finished with in, drops it. This creation, population, use and drop is all expensive and robs performance. The procedure in Figure 24 is more efficient.

Figure 24: Using PL/SQL Tables to speed processing.

In this limited example the average execution time dropped from 8.16 seconds to 8.06 seconds. With larger IO amounts (this was only 34 lines output to the Oracle table.) Note that the code has been simplified by removing the line count code and the commits. If the SELECT actions in the WRITE_OUT internal procedure that go against the DUAL table where removed performance could be increased even more.
